Si estàs començant en el món de la programació, potser et preguntaràs en què consisteixen els diferents codis i quines són les característiques i beneficis de cadascun. En l’article d’avui t’oferim una comparativa Kotlin vs. JavaScript perquè sàpigues triar quin és el llenguatge de programació més indicat per a cada lloc web.
Kotlin vs. Javascript: característiques i beneficis
A continuació, comparem Kotlin i JavaScript per ajudar-te a triar el llenguatge de programació més adequat per a cada projecte. Aquests són els principals beneficis i característiques que ofereix Kotlin:
- Ofereix una migració senzilla i segura. Permet fer proves amb només una part del codi, sense alterar-ne la totalitat.
- Elimina els NPE (null pointer exception) del codi.
- Admet suport per a variables genèriques.
- Permet importar disseny de manera estàtica.
- Pot treballar amb frameworks o llibreries JQuery, React o Angular, entre altres.
- Té una excel·lent compatibilitat amb Android Studio.
- És compatible amb Java i permet desenvolupaments multiplataforma.
- Té una corba d’aprenentatge curta, ja que la seva sintaxi és molt simple i fàcil de llegir.
Per la seva banda, el codi Javascript ofereix els avantatges i prestacions següents:
- És un llenguatge de programació de plataforma independent, per la qual cosa pot ser executat en qualsevol hardware.
- Disposa d’un recol·lector de brossa que permet alliberar i optimitzar la memòria.
- Permet dur a terme diferents tasques simultàniament, amb la qual cosa millora tant la velocitat d’execució com el rendiment del software desenvolupat.
- Mitjançant l’XML (extensible markup language) podem crear llocs web dinàmics.
- És un llenguatge multiplataforma, amb elevats nivells de seguretat.
- Permet utilitzar funcions i classes i admet l’ús d’operadors lògics, blocs, expressions i sentències.
- La seva corba d’aprenentatge és ràpida, gràcies a la seva escriptura senzilla.
- Disposa d’una àmplia biblioteca i d’una gran comunitat activa d’usuaris.
Quan hem d’utilitzar cada llenguatge?
Ara que coneixes una mica més sobre Kotlin i Java, podem concloure que Kotlin és un llenguatge molt pràctic i flexible, sobretot per desenvolupar aplicacions mòbils en Android. Per la seva banda, Javascript és una bona opció per construir projectes petits o millorar la qualitat de pàgines HTML ja existents.
Si t’interessa la programació i estàs buscant una opció formativa que tingui sortides professionals, cursa el cicle formatiu de grau superior de Desenvolupament d’Aplicacions Web. Aprendràs a desenvolupar i mantenir aplicacions web utilitzant els diferents llenguatges de programació que existeixen avui.